Output 58103b569730b1ce9751755e93dc9e22428917175d70607ac0eb3198a360cac1:1

value
461042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ac463fedcc677eee281036104b76c048ea996a0 OP_EQUAL
address
3HFx4cYHZWqgS29FR8oLWoAdYTXnCJmRPq
transaction
58103b569730b1ce9751755e93dc9e22428917175d70607ac0eb3198a360cac1
confirmations
171434
spent
true